Address

ecash:qzxyzkveyw54ma3ackqd4t2nw7p48gfzlcxqh6thkxCopy

Total Received

1104476.73 XEC

Total Sent

1036201.3 XEC

№ Transactions

163

Final Balance

68275.43 XEC

Transactions
Filter